Here’s a list of JEE Mains questions on Limit, Continuity, and Differentiability along with their solutions:

  1. The limit of (sin x)/x as x approaches 0 is:
    • A) 0
    • B) 1
    • C) Infinity
    • D) Does not exist

      Solution: The correct answer is B) 1. The limit of (sin x)/x as x approaches 0 is 1.

      (This question has been asked thrice- JEE Main 2018, JEE Main 2022, JEE Main 2024)

  2. Which of the following is a continuous function?
    • A) f(x) = 1/x
    • B) f(x) = x^2
    • C) f(x) = sin(1/x)
    • D) f(x) = tan(x)

      Solution: The correct answer is B) f(x) = x^2. It is continuous for all real x.

      (This question has been asked thrice- JEE Main 2018, JEE Main 2022, JEE Main 2024)

  3. If f(x) = x^2 - 4, find f'(2).
    • A) 0
    • B) 2
    • C) 4
    • D) 8

      Solution: The correct answer is C) 4. f'(x) = 2x; thus, f'(2) = 2*2 = 4.

  4. The continuity of f(x) at x = a requires:
    • A) f(a) must be defined
    • B) lim x->a f(x) must exist
    • C) lim x->a f(x) = f(a)
    • D) All of the above

      Solution: The correct answer is D) All of the above. All conditions must be satisfied for continuity.

  5. What is the derivative of f(x) = e^x?
    • A) e^x
    • B) x*e^x
    • C) 1/e^x
    • D) None of these

      Solution: The correct answer is A) e^x. The derivative of e^x is e^x.

  6. The function f(x) = |x| is continuous at:
    • A) x = 0
    • B) x > 0
    • C) x < 0
    • D) All real x

      Solution: The correct answer is D) All real x. The absolute value function is continuous everywhere.
